Where do you get appropriate hive jars for AWS?

When trying to connect to Hive on AWS EMR Talend asks for these jars:



Amazon's documentation for the Hive JDBC driver  includes files with partially correct names but some like hive-exec-0.13.1-amzn-2.jar aren't there at all.  Where can we find the correct versions of these jars?
